Robot relay solution

Industrial robots demand extremely high requirements for control precision, response speed, and safety reliability. Relay applications are concentrated in key areas such as joint motion control, safety circuit protection, and end-effector actuation.

Joint Motor Control

  • Core Requirements: Precise start/stop, forward/reverse control, and high-speed response.

  • Main Types and Applications:

    • Electromagnetic Power Relay:

      • Capable of handling high currents, meeting the drive requirements of joint motors.

      • Provides reliable start/stop and forward/reverse control for motors.

    • High-Frequency Solid-State Relay (SSR):

      • Offers microsecond-level response speed, suitable for high-frequency commutation control.

      • Used in scenarios with stringent positioning accuracy and high operating frequency requirements.

Safety Circuit Protection

  • Core Requirements: Ensuring personnel and equipment safety, complying with international safety standards.

  • Key Requirement: Products must comply with safety standards such as EN ISO 13849.

  • Main Types and Applications:

    • Safety Relay / Forced-Guided Contact Relay:

      • Used for signal processing and actuation of safety devices like emergency stop buttons, safety doors, and light curtains.

      • Can reliably and forcibly cut off the robot’s main power circuit in situations like an open safety door or triggered emergency stop.

End-Effector Actuation

  • Core Requirements: Precise and reliable switching and time-delay control.

  • Main Types and Applications:

    • Electromagnetic Signal Relay:

      • Compact size, stable performance.

      • Provides on/off control for end-effectors such as robot grippers, welding torches, and pneumatic cylinders.

    • Time-Delay Relay:

      • Used in scenarios requiring delayed actions for precise timing control.

      • Typical applications include: delayed welding ignition, delayed gripper clamping/release.

Load and Equipment Protection

  • Core Requirements: Real-time current monitoring to prevent equipment damage from abnormal conditions.

  • Main Types and Applications:

    • Thermal Overload Relay / Electronic Overload Relay:

      • Continuously monitors the operating current of joint motors and end-effectors.

      • Cuts off the circuit promptly in case of overload, short circuit, or other faults to protect the equipment.

Special Environment Applications

  • Core Requirements: Meeting specific operational needs such as spark-free operation and high vibration resistance.

  • Main Types and Applications:

    • Solid-State Relay (SSR):

      • No mechanical contacts, resulting in spark-free operation, suitable for clean rooms, explosive atmospheres.

      • Excellent vibration resistance, capable of withstanding vibrations from continuous robot motion.

      • The preferred alternative to traditional electromagnetic relays in such special environments.
